Vagai Chandrasekhar, a veteran and renowned character actor in the Tamil film industry, has been announced as the recipient of the prestigious “Yuva Puraskar” National Award, presented by the Sangeet Natak Akademi of the Central Government. This high honor is being bestowed upon him in recognition of his overall contribution to theatre and the arts.
Born on May 3, 1956, in the village of Vagaikulam in the Thoothukudi district, Chandrasekhar showed a deep passion for stage plays and cultural events from a very young age. The name ‘Vagai’ became permanently associated with him as a symbol of his realistic acting success, referencing the ancient Tamil tradition of crowning victorious warriors with wreaths made of Vagai (Siris) flowers.
Making his debut in Tamil cinema in the 1980s, his realistic and unique acting skills allowed him to leave a lasting mark in over 300 films, portraying diverse roles ranging from character characters to antagonists.
Kalaimamani Award: In appreciation of his outstanding service to the arts, the Government of Tamil Nadu honored him with the ‘Kalaimamani’ award in 1991.

National Film Award: He has also won the National Film Award for Best Supporting Actor for his stellar performance in the movie Nanba Nanba.
Not limiting himself to the world of arts, Vagai Chandrasekhar also made a significant mark in active politics. He served efficiently as a Member of the Legislative Assembly (MLA) for the Velachery constituency representing the DMK party. Currently, he serves as the Chairman of the Tamil Nadu Iyal Isai Nataka Manram (Tamil Nadu State Academy of Literature, Music and Drama).
Operated under the Ministry of Culture of the Central Government, the Sangeet Natak Akademi Award is the highest national recognition conferred for the performing arts in India.
These awards are primarily presented under 5 categories:
Music
Dance
Drama / Theatre
Traditional / Folk & Tribal Arts
Puppetry and Allied Arts / Research
